3D Printing in Dental Surgery



To boost the area of dental surgery, you can explore the subtopic of 3D printing in dental surgery. This innovative modern technology has the possible to change the way dental surgeons run and treat individuals. Right here are 4 essential methods which 3D printing is forming the area:

- ** Customized Surgical Guides **: 3D printing permits the creation of very accurate and patient-specific medical guides, boosting the precision and effectiveness of treatments.

- ** Implant Prosthetics **: With 3D printing, dental specialists can develop tailored implant prosthetics that perfectly fit an individual's one-of-a-kind anatomy, leading to better results and person fulfillment.

- ** Bone Grafting **: 3D printing allows the manufacturing of patient-specific bone grafts, reducing the need for typical implanting techniques and enhancing recovery and healing time.

- ** Education and learning and Training **: 3D printing can be made use of to create practical surgical versions for instructional objectives, enabling dental specialists to practice complicated treatments prior to executing them on clients.

With its possible to enhance precision, customization, and training, 3D printing is an interesting development in the field of dental surgery.
